A lot of people believe this but it's not true. Referral payments have come out of a separate budget and don't eat into author payments at all.

The author reaction against this really suprised me. I wasn't CEO when it rolled out but I've seen a lot of discussion about it.

I was expecting the opposite reaction.

If Medium only pays for internal views, then each author is in competition for those views. It's a zero sum game and has led to a lot of dillution of earnings. Essentially, new authors eat into the earnings of existing authors. That's the fundamental reason author earnings have dropped.

Referrals and other forms of paying authors who grow the pie are really healthy for existing authors. They make more money and page views available for the authors who are here.
